José de Jesús Cortés Oaxaca, Mexico, Oct 2 (EFE). – Indigenous farmers from southern Mexico are organizing and creating seed banks to defend traditional maize from the climate crisis, in the midst of the Mexican government’s fight against genetically modified grains, mainly from the United States.
